Programme Overview
The Undergraduate Certificate in Optimizing Systems with Evolutionary Methods is designed to equip students with a comprehensive understanding of evolutionary algorithms and their applications in optimizing complex systems. This program is ideal for undergraduate students, professionals in fields such as engineering, computer science, and operations research, who seek to enhance their ability to solve real-world optimization problems through advanced computational techniques. It is also suitable for those interested in pursuing advanced studies or careers in fields that require a deep understanding of optimization strategies.
Learners will develop a range of key skills and knowledge, including an in-depth understanding of various evolutionary algorithms such as genetic algorithms, particle swarm optimization, and differential evolution. They will also gain proficiency in applying these algorithms to solve diverse optimization problems, from engineering design challenges to data-driven decision-making scenarios. Additionally, students will learn to implement these algorithms using programming languages such as Python and MATLAB, and will be introduced to the latest research trends and applications in the field.

Topics Covered
- Foundational Concepts: Covers the core principles and key terminology.: Historical Perspectives: Examines the development of evolutionary methods from their inception to current applications.
- Genetic Algorithms: Explains the theory and implementation of genetic algorithms in problem-solving.: Evolutionary Strategies: Discusses the principles and applications of evolutionary strategies in optimization.
- Swarm Intelligence: Investigates the behavior of decentralized, self-organized systems and their applications.: Hybrid Methods: Analyzes the integration of evolutionary methods with other optimization techniques.
